This is a rare 1926 shellac 78 RPM record from The Little Ramblers, a notable jazz ensemble of the era. Released on the iconic Columbia 'Viva-tonal' black and gold label, this 10-inch disc features the tracks 'And Then I Forget' on side A and 'My Cutey's Due At Two-To-Two To-Day' on side B. Both tracks are performed in the classic Fox Trot style with vocal choruses, capturing the vibrant energy of the mid-1920s jazz scene.

The Little Ramblers were known for their sophisticated arrangements and featured several prominent musicians from the California Ramblers circle. This specific pressing, catalog number 719-D, is a fantastic piece of music history for collectors of early jazz and dance band records. The label design reflects the transition into electrical recording processes, making it a significant addition to any pre-war record collection.
